Онлайн парсер картинок с сайтов, из Вконтакте, Пинтереста и т

Если картинка в формате WebP (веб-страница)

Сейчас достаточно распространён формат изображений WebP, продвигаемый компанией Google в качестве альтернативы JPG для сайтов. Действительно, в формате WebP изображение занимает значительно меньше места при том же качестве. Однако при попытке скачать такие картинки браузер показывает формат сохраняемого файла "веб-страница", а сам сохранённый файл потом не открывается.

Таким образом, сохранить картинку WebP не проблема. Проблема её потом открыть. В этом случае помогут два способа: сделать скриншот и сохранить уже его или скачать картинку как есть, а потом её конвертировать в JPG или любой другой формат.

Лучше, конечно, второй способ, поскольку первый часто не позволяет сохранить изображение в высоком разрешении. В качестве конвертора картинок можно посоветовать онлайн-инструмент от компании Google, который называется squoosh.app.

Как парсить картинки с социальных сетей

Парсинг фотов из Инстаграм, ВКонтакте, Фейсбук и других социальных сетей обычно происходит с помощью онлайн-сервисов. Но чаще всего пользователям доступна такая услуга по подписке.

Pepper.Ninja

На некоторых сервисах предусмотрена возможность выполнить парсинг фото из ВКонтакте, Инстаграм и других социальных сетей бесплатно. Но есть ограничения на количество запросов или скачиваемых фото. По исчерпанию установленного лимита нужно платить деньги. 

Парсинг фото из социальной сетей происходит по следующему алгоритму:

  1. Нужно открыть сервис.
  2. Указать в специальной форме адрес личной страницы или паблика в социальной сети.
  3. Установить нужные фильтры (по дате, количеству фото и т.д.).
  4. Нажать кнопку «Парсить».

Онлайн-сервис проведет поиск нужных фото, а потом предложит их выгрузку удобным вам способов.

Другие способы скопировать картинку с сайта

В самом крайнем случае вы можете использовать клавишу PrintScreen, после чего вставить скриншот в Paint или другой графический редактор. Конечно, этот способ очень примитивен и лучше его не использовать. Кроме того, вместе с нужным вам изображением скопируется много чего ещё и придётся картинку обрезать.

Как сохранить картинку с сайта, если она не сохраняется

Это достаточно распространённый случай в практике пользователей интернета. Вы хотите сохранить понравившееся фото на компьютер, а в меню нет нужного пункта! Давайте посмотрим, что можно сделать в этом случае и как сохранить фотографию с сайта если нет "Сохранить как..." в контекстном меню. Более того, при правом щелчке мышкой меню может вообще не появляться.

Показывать тут различные варианты в виде скриншотов я не буду, поскольку в конечном итоге все способы защиты от копирования изображений сводятся либо к блокировке меню, либо к показу иного меню вместо стандартного, в котором нет нужного для сохранения картинки пункта. Вместо рассмотрения каждого варианта в отдельности я покажу вам универсальный способ как сохранить фото с сайта на компьютер. Этот метод я буду показывать на примере браузера Google Chrome, поскольку он наиболее удобен для подобных операций.

Для начала вспомните то, что я писал выше, а именно: всё, что вы видите на странице сайта, УЖЕ у вас на компьютере (либо на диске, либо в оперативной памяти браузера). Всё что нужно, это посмотреть что там есть и выбрать нужное. Как же это сделать?

Очень просто. В Google Chrome нажмите F12 для показа специальной панели, предназначенной для разработчиков. Не стоит заранее пугаться — сложного тут ничего нет. Эта панель не имеет отношения к открытому сайту, поэтому она появится в любом случае, вне зависимости от того, есть на сайте защита от скачивания картинок или нет. Выглядит это приблизительно вот так.

Вам не нужно разбираться в особенностях данного инструмента. Тем не менее, описывать в тексте статьи как именно при помощи панели разработчика можно скачать картинку с сайта, если она не скачивается, достаточно долго. Поэтому я показал это в видеоролике ниже.

Как сохранить фотографию с сайта если она не сохраняется, смотрите на видео. Обратите внимание, что показанным ниже способом можно извлечь с ЛЮБОГО сайта не только изображения, но и вообще ЛЮБЫЕ ресурсы. Если у вас не получилось — значит, извините, плохо смотрели.

Парсинг изображения с относительным путем

При настройке парсинга фото нужно учитывать, что на многих сайтах ссылки на них представлены в относительном виде. Иными словами, путь файлу изображению указан относительно корневой папке на сервере. В данном случае есть два момента, которые нужно запомнить:

  • Во-первых, когда ищите в коде странице ссылку на фото, то абсолютной ссылки для копирования в браузер вы не найдете. Поэтому перед поиском нужно удалить из нее название домена с последним слешем. Например, http://conter.ru/wp-content/uploads/2018/10/SHpargalka-po-git-720×414.jpg. Для получения относительной ссылки удаляем http://conter.ru/wp-content/uploads/, получаем: /uploads/2018/10/SHpargalka-po-git-720×414.jpg. В этом случае у вас получится относительная ссылка на картинку.
  • Во-вторых, относительной ссылки недостаточно для парсинга. Нужно указывать полный адрес к изображению. Для этого чаще всего нужно добавить домен, сбросить параметры размера и дописать img.png. В итоге полный адрес к изображению из нашего примера будет выглядит следующим образом: http://conter.ru/wp-content/uploads/2018/10/img.png.

Как скачивать сразу много картинок

Все способы, о которых рассказывается выше, подходят, только когда речь идет о сохранении одной или нескольких картинок, так как в таком случае это не займет у вас много времени и сил. Если же вам нужно сохранить большое количество картинок, например, вы хотите сохранить себе сотни фото из аккаунта вашего кумира в Инстаграме, или много тематических картинок из поиска в Гугл.Картинках и т.п., то сохранять их вручную по одной будет очень нудно и долго.

Чтобы сделать массовую скачку картинок быстро и легко, можно воспользоваться специальным онлайн сервисом:

  • http://backlinks-checker.dimax.biz/tools/parser_kartinok.php

Вам нужно будет лишь указать URL-адрес сайта, с которого вы хотите скачать картинки, и спустя несколько минут получить готовый архив с ними! Данный сервис скачивает фотографии или любые другие типы картинок практически с каких угодно вебсайтов, включая самые популярные, такие как Instagram, Вконтакте, Яндекс.картинки и другие.

Программы для парсинга картинок

Существует десятки программ для парсинга картинок. Большинство из них схожи по функционалу и принципу работы. Некоторые предполагают покупку лицензии, другие доступны пользователям бесплатно. Мы решили рассмотреть самые популярные ПО для поиска картинок.

Image Parser

Image Parser – бесплатный парсер картинок, представленный в качестве расширения для Google Chrome. Значок плагина появляется в панели браузера после установки.

Чтобы запустить поиск изображений, нужно открыть сайт и кликнуть по иконке расширения. В новом окне появятся все найденные изображения на выбранном ресурсе. Находит данный софт картинки в тегах IMG и подключаемых файлах стилей, а также в «защищенных» страницах. Все изображения можно сохранить в ZIP архив.

Плюсы

  • Бесплатная программа
  • Можно скачивать картинки в форматах png, jpg, jpeg, gif.
  • Парсит «защищенные» с данными страницы.

Поддерживается парсинг ссылок на картинки.

Минусы

  • Для запуска программы нужно открыть сайт.
  • Нельзя парсить одновременно несколько ресурсов, что снижает скорость поиска картинок.  
  • Нет фильтров для выборки изображений.

ImageGrabber RX

ImageGrabber RX – платная программа для парсинга изображений. Может анализировать одновременно десятки сайтов, искать картинки на определенном источнике. Поддерживается фильтрация изображений по размеру. При поиске происходит сравнение фото-контента с базой. Происходит выгрузка только уникальных картинок, которые ранее не скачивались в локальное хранилище.

Плюсы

  • Высокая скорость работы.
  • Анализ картинок с базой для выборки уникальных изображений.
  • Фильтрация мелких картинок.

Минусы

  • Нужно покупать лицензию на использование.
  • Не всегда ПО обходит защиту страниц.

GoogleImageFinder

GoogleImageFinder – парсер картинок с сайта images.google. Отличается интуитивно понятным интерфейсом и простым запуском для работы. Для поиска изображений требуется указать их количество, нужное разрешение и размер, ключевые слова и директорию для загрузки. После нажатия на кнопку «Старт» программа начнет парсинг. Для каждого запроса можно создавать отдельные папки, а потом уникализировать скачанные изображения по выбранным параметрам.

GoogleImageFinder

Плюсы

  • Есть демо-версия.
  • Поддерживается широкий набор инструментов.
  • Быстрая работа.
  • Можно сохранять исходные названия картинок.
  • Поддерживается парсинг ссылок на картинки с сайта, чтобы чтобы сэкономить место в своем хранилище.
  • Уникализация картинок по заданным параметрам.

Минусы

  • Нужно покупать лицензию после использования программы в демо-версии.

Не поддерживается парсинг картинок с Яндекс, поиск происходит только с images.google.

PictureGoogleGraber

PictureGoogleGraber – бесплатный парсер картинок с Гугл с простым интерфейсом. По умолчанию программа скачивает самые большие изображения из доступных, но можно задать свои параметры по высоте и ширине. Также можно выбрать ориентацию и тип разрешения. Скачиваются не только картинки, но и их URL. Сохранение происходит одновременно из 10 потоков.

PictureGoogleGraber

Плюсы

  • Не нужно покупать лицензию.
  • Быстрая работа.
  • Загрузка URL картинок в отдельный файл.

Минусы

  • Небольшой спектр настроек для выборки картинок.
  • Иногда блокируется антивирусными программами.

Обход защит от парсинга картинок

При парсинге картинок с сайтов нередко приходится сталкиваться с защитами. Некоторые программы и сервисы предусматривают обход большинства из них. Но когда ресурсы создаются на языке программирования высокого уровня, то чаще всего с них не удается скачать нужные изображения. Например, затруднителен парсинг картинок с сайтов на Python. Но есть пути решения такой проблемы. 

Основной принцип обхода защиты от парсинга изображения на Python, PHP и других сайтах состоит в изменении поведенческих факторов. Нужно выставлять такие параметры для программы, которые будут схожи с пользовательскими запросами:

  • Задержки. Их устанавливают между запросами к чужим сайтам. Но учтите, что в этом случае скорость парсинга картинок с Python PHP и других сайтов снизится.
  • Смена IP. Если вы часто парсите фото на одном ресурсе, то меняйте IP. Для этого достаточно перезагрузить роутер.
  • Активируйте получение и отправку куки, если такая опция доступна в выбранной программе. 

Когда парсинг картинок с PHP, Python и других сайтов блокируется, попробуйте воспользоваться их мобильными версиями. Обычно они менее защищены, что позволяет скачивать с них любой нужный фото-контент.

Пример: как сохранить фотографию с сайта знакомств

Заключается он в том, что нужно вызвать контекстное меню (щёлкнуть ПРАВОЙ кнопкой мышки) на той картинке, которую вы хотите себе сохранить. Напоминаю, что любая картинка на любом сайте — это объект, у которого есть определённые свойства и с которым можно выполнить некоторые действия. Список этих действий как раз и показывает меню, вызываемое правым щелчком мышки на картинке.

Попробуйте таким образом скопировать и сохранить к себе на компьютер любую картинку с этой страницы. Это очень просто!

В разных браузерах вид меню и названия его пунктов может отличаться, но смысл всегда один и тот же. Ниже показано контекстное меню для браузера Google Chrome. Также не путайте пункт меню, выделенный на скриншоте и "Сохранить как...". Последний отвечает за сохранение ВСЕЙ страницы целиком и вам не подходит!

Допустим вы хотите сохранить фотографию с сайта знакомств. В таком случае ищите в меню пункт, отвечающий за сохранение изображения. При выборе его браузер предложит вам указать место на вашем компьютере, куда нужно сохранить копию фотографии. Окно сохранения фотографии будет выглядеть приблизительно вот так.

Дальше всё просто — выбираете папку для сохранения и нажимаете "Сохранить". Вы также можете указать имя сохраняемого файла, поскольку чаще всего при сохранении изображений с сайтов имена картинок бывают неудобными для чтения. Изменение имени не обязательно, а вот папку для сохранения выберите сами, поскольку Windows часто предлагает сохранять картинки "непонятно куда", так что вы их потом никогда не найдёте.

Вот и всё, дело сделано! Если же вы всё сделали правильно, но не получилось, значит владельцы сайта против копирования материалов посетителями. В таком случае читайте дальше.

Как сохранить картинку с сайта на компьютер — общие сведения

Сейчас я покажу вам как скачать картинку с сайта на компьютер в самом простом и наиболее распространённом случае. Функция сохранения фотографий из интернета на компьютер по умолчанию уже есть во всех браузерах, поэтому не стоит искать в интернете какое-то особое расширение для браузера или тем более специальную программу для копирования фотографий с сайтов. Всё это уже есть!

Запомните:

Если вы открыли страницу какого-нибудь сайта и она успешно загрузилась, значит всё что на ней показано УЖЕ у вас на компьютере! Всё что нужно, это сохранить то что вам требуется ИЗ БРАУЗЕРА в нужное вам место на диске.

А вот тут уже есть различные варианты действий в зависимости от того, что это за сайт и как именно на его страницах представлены фотографии и другие картинки. Поэтому-то и существуют различные способы копирования изображений со страниц сайта. Давайте рассмотрим самый простой.

Как сохранить движущуюся картинку с сайта

Смотря что подразумевать под "движущимися картинками". Если речь идёт о копировании видео с ютуба, то почитайте об этом здесь. Но обычно подразумеваются анимированные изображения в формате GIF. Сохранить GIF с сайта можно в точности теми же способами, которые уже были показаны выше. Если ничего не получается, значит это не GIF картинка, а что-то иное.

Обзор инструментов для парсинга картинок

Для парсинга изображений создано огромное количество инструментов. Все они подразделяются на несколько основных категорий. Разберем каждую из них подробно.

Онлайн-сервисы

Онлайн сервис для парсинга

Большой популярностью пользуются онлайн-сервисы. Они позволяют сразу перейти к парсингу картинок, минуя необходимость проводить установку ПО. Вы задаете параметры поиска, запускаете процесс и ожидаете результатов. Выгрузку найденных изображений можно проводить на ПК, съемный носитель или облачное хранилище.

К преимуществам онлайн-сервисов для поиска изображений относится:

  • Простота использования.
  • Не нужно тратить время на скачивание и инсталляцию софта.
  • Быстрый процесс поиска изображений.
  • Возможность создания общего архива для файлов с одного источника.

Есть у онлайн-сервисов ряд недостатков, к ним относится:

  • Многопоточный режим обычно ограничивается 5-10 сайтами.
  • Небольшое количество настроек для поиска.

Есть ограничения на количество фото, которое можно спарсить из социальных сетей в рамках одного запроса.

Десктопные парсеры картинок

Десктопные парсеры картинок – программные решения для поиска изображений. Софт отличается по интерфейсу, функционалу, параметрам поиска и другим критериям. Для начала работы нужно выполнить установку программки на компьютер, выполнить предварительную настройку, а потом запустить парсинг фото. Их загрузка будет выполнена в выбранную директорию.

Парсер Гугл

К основным преимуществам использования десктопных парсеров картинок относится:

  • Не нужно каждый раз выполнять настройку, можно проводить поиск изображений по выбранным параметрам.
  • Поддержка широкого функционала (выборка размеров картинок, их ориентации, разрешения и т.д.).
  • Удобное сканирование нескольких ресурсов. Например, парсинг картинок с Content Downloader можно проводить в многопоточном режиме, активировав автоматическую загрузку результативных файлов в выбранные папки. 
  • Поддержка уникализации найденных картинок.

Есть у десктопных парсеров некоторые недостатки, в их числе: 

  • Нужно тратить время на установку.
  • Есть ограничения в бесплатных версиях
  • Большая часть софта предлагается на платной основе.

Сервисы по подписке

Существуют онлайн-сервисы по подписке. Пользователям предлагаются разные тарифные планы. Они могут предусматривать оплату за парсинг определенного количества картинок или право на пользование сервисом в течение дня, недели, месяца или полугода.

У онлайн-сервисов для парсинга изображений по подписке следующие преимущества:

  • Поддержка более широко спектра возможностей, чем у бесплатных сервисов для парсинга контента в формате фото.
  • Нет ограничений по массовой выгрузке.
  • Возможность задействовать в многопоточном режиме более 10 источников.

Недостаток таких онлайн-сервисов понятен – нужно оплачивать подписки. Стоимость на них варьируется, начиная от $5 и достигая $100.

Парсеры надстройки картинок

Есть также парсеры надстройки картинок. Здесь идет речь о специальных скриптах, которые создаются для MS Excel. По сути, они представляют собой набор макросов, которые отвечают за выполнение определенных функций.

Выбор надстроек

К парсерам надстройки обязательно идут скрипты для их управления.

К преимуществам парсеров в виде надстроек для поиска изображений относится:

  • Скрипт не нагружает операционную систему ПК.
  • Удобный формат формирования базы с URL картинками.
  • Легкий поиск нужных изображений.

К недостаткам парсеров в формате надстройки для поиска картинок относится:

  • Небольшой функционал.
  • Невысокая скорость работы.
  • Часто возникновение ошибок.

Парсим поиск картинок

При рассмотрении программ выше, мы упоминали о возможности парсинга изображения из поисковых систем.

Парсер Яндекс картинок

Это наиболее простой и удобный вариант в случаях, когда нет конкретных источников для скачивания картинок – есть только ключевые слова. Но поскольку в поисковых системах многомиллионная база изображений, то важно делать правильную выборку. Запуская парсер картинок по ключевым словам, обязательно укажите следующие параметры:

  • графический формат изображения;
  • ориентация картинки;
  • минимальный и максимальный размер изображения;
  • максимальный объем файла.  

Указав такие свойства картинок, вы сможете сузить поиск. Парсер вам выдаст наиболее подходящие изображения из выдачи, что упростит их дальнейшую выборку для своего сайта или паблика в социальной сети.

Подведём итоги

Если вы внимательно читали данную статью, то у вас не должно остаться вопросов по сохранению фотографий с абсолютно любых сайтов. Сразу скажу, что есть дополнительные особенности копирования картинок, которые здесь не показаны, но можно обойтись и без этого.

Если вам встретился особо сложный случай и вы самостоятельно никак не можете сделать то, что вам нужно, можете обратиться ко мне за пояснениями. Я могу научить вас всем особенностям за один-два часа. Услуга платная, но того стоит.

Источники

  • https://prozavr.ru/tools/parser_kartinok.php
  • https://artemvm.info/information/uchebnye-stati/internet/kak-sohranit-kartinku-s-sajta/
  • https://markedata.io/kak-parsit-kartinki/
[свернуть]
Поделиться:

Оставьте ком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*